Course summary

Self-care is of particular importance for health practitioners when they work with the emergency services sector. This course is designed to help practitioners understand the risk factors and impact of vicarious trauma, burnout, and moral injury and employ strategies that will enhance health, wellbeing and resilience.

Course aims

This course aims to help practitioners: 

  • Understand the role of self-care when working with emergency service workers 
  • Enhance and maintain resilience
  • Understand risk factors for and the impact of vicarious trauma, burnout, and moral injury
  • Develop and implement a self-care plan to support their work with emergency service workers.
Course learning outcomes

After taking this course practitioners will be able to:

  • Be more familiar with a range of self-care strategies
  • Have developed a self-care plan for use during their work with Emergency Workers.
